About Apex

Apex Space manufactures ESPA class satellites, focusing on their flagship product, the Aries satellite bus, which is suitable for Low Earth Orbit (LEO) and other missions. They cater to clients in the aerospace and defense sectors, providing customizable satellite solutions for applications like Earth observation and communications. Apex Space differentiates itself with guaranteed on-time delivery, high reliability, and transparent pricing. Their goal is to lead in spacecraft manufacturing by offering dependable satellite solutions for a variety of space missions.

Differentiation

Apex specializes in ESPA class satellites, ranging from 40 to 400 kilograms.
The Aries satellite bus supports LEO, MEO, GEO, and deep space missions.
Apex guarantees on-time delivery, high reliability, and transparent pricing.
